As for my regimen, here is what I do, every morning I put conditioner VO5 Tea Therapy and olive oil on my hair, put on a shower cap and leave it on long enough to eat breakfast and drink a cup of coffee or tea. I detangle with my shower comb just before rinsing it out. After all the conditioner is out I put on my turbie towel for not even a minute then I grease my scalp and spray each section as I grease my scalp with braid spray.
Once I am done I put on a head band, fluff my fro, and I'm ready to go.
Every Friday I shampoo my hair with VO5 Tea Therapy.
So thats pretty much it. The products in my regimen are as follows:
VO5 Tea Therapy Shampoo and Conditioner
Olive oil
Blue Magic hair grease mixed with a little MTG
Braid Spray
